下载此文档

计算几何PPTPPT课件.pptx


文档分类:高等教育 | 页数:约84页 举报非法文档有奖
1/84
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/84 下载此文档
文档列表 文档介绍
该【计算几何PPTPPT课件 】是由【非学无以广才】上传分享,文档一共【84】页,该文档可以免费在线阅读,需要了解更多关于【计算几何PPTPPT课件 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。计算几何
钟思思
/
1
1/84
目录
序言
准备知识
向量
多边形
Voronoi介绍
例题讲解
2
2/84
序言
3
3/84
序言
计算几何是计算机理论科学一个主要分支。
自20世纪70年代末从算法设计与分析中独立出来起,不到30年,该学科已经有了巨大发展,不但产生了一系列主要理论结果,也在众多实际领域中得到了广泛应用。
常见应用领域:计算机图形学,机器人学,地理信息系统(GIS),CAD/CAM………..
4
4/84
序言
在ICPC竞赛中,计算几何相比于其它部分来说是比较独立。
除近年来出现与图论和动态规划相结合题目,计算几何与其它知识点极少有过多结合。
计算几何题目难度不会很大,但也永远不会成为最弱题。
计算几何题目含有代码量大、特殊情况多、精度问题难以控制等特点。
5
5/84
准备知识
6
6/84
准备知识
头文件#include<cmath>
浮点数double
常量
constdoublePI=acos(-);
#
constdoubleINF=1e100;
constdoubleEPS=1e-6;
7
7/84
准备知识
符号函数
intsign(doubled)
{
if(fabs(d)<EPS)return0;
return(d>0)?1:-1;
}
8
8/84
准备知识
浮点数转化成整数
地板函数floor(x)
天花板函数ceil(x)
四舍五入(int)(x+)
下取整(int)(x+ERROR)
尽可能少用三角函数、除法、开方、求幂、取对数
9
9/84
浮点误差
请不要直接用等号判断浮点数是否相等!
处理方法一,误差判断法:
constdoubleEPS=1e-9;
浮点数判断相等,fabs(x-y)<EPS;
浮点数判断为零,fabs(x)<EPS。
处理方法二,化浮为整法:
在不溢出整数范围情况下,能够经过乘上10k次方,转化为整数运算,最终在将结果转化为整数。
10
10/84

计算几何PPTPPT课件 来自淘豆网m.daumloan.com转载请标明出处.

非法内容举报中心
文档信息